43 /*
44  * Initialize the TWI hardware registers.
45  */
at91_twi_hwinit(void)46 static void __devinit at91_twi_hwinit(void)
47 {
48 	unsigned long cdiv, ckdiv;
49 
50 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_IDR, 0xffffffff);	/* Disable all interrupts */
51 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_SWRST);	/* Reset peripheral */
52 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_MSEN);	/* Set Master mode */
53 
54 	/* Calcuate clock dividers */
55 	cdiv = (clk_get_rate(twi_clk) / (2 * TWI_CLOCK)) - 3;
56 	cdiv = cdiv + 1;	/* round up */
57 	ckdiv = 0;
58 	while (cdiv > 255) {
59 		ckdiv++;
60 		cdiv = cdiv >> 1;
61 	}
62 
63 	if (cpu_is_at91rm9200()) {			/* AT91RM9200 Errata #22 */
64 		if (ckdiv > 5) {
65 			printk(KERN_ERR "AT91 I2C: Invalid TWI_CLOCK value!\n");
66 			ckdiv = 5;
67 		}
68 	}
69 
70 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CWGR, (ckdiv << 16) | (cdiv << 8) | cdiv);
71 }
72 
73 /*
74  * Poll the i2c status register until the specified bit is set.
75  * Returns 0 if timed out (100 msec).
76  */
at91_poll_status(unsigned long bit)77 static short at91_poll_status(unsigned long bit)
78 {
79 	int loop_cntr = 10000;
80 
81 	do {
82 		udelay(10);
83 	} while (!(at91_twi_read(AT91_TWI_SR) & bit) && (--loop_cntr > 0));
84 
85 	return (loop_cntr > 0);
86 }
87 
xfer_read(struct i2c_adapter * adap,unsigned char * buf,int length)88 static int xfer_read(struct i2c_adapter *adap, unsigned char *buf, int length)
89 {
90 	/* Send Start */
91 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_START);
92 
93 	/* Read data */
94 	while (length--) {
95 		if (!length)	/* need to send Stop before reading last byte */
96 			at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_STOP);
97 		if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_RXRDY)) {
98 			d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"RXRDY timeout\n");
99 			return -ETIMEDOUT;
100 		}
101 		*buf++ = (at91_twi_read(AT91_TWI_RHR) & 0xff);
102 	}
103 
104 	return 0;
105 }
106 
xfer_write(struct i2c_adapter * adap,unsigned char * buf,int length)107 static int xfer_write(struct i2c_adapter *adap, unsigned char *buf, int length)
108 {
109 	/* Load first byte into transmitter */
110 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_THR, *buf++);
111 
112 	/* Send Start */
113 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_START);
114 
115 	do {
116 		if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_TXRDY)) {
117 			d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"TXRDY timeout\n");
118 			return -ETIMEDOUT;
119 		}
120 
121 		length--;	/* byte was transmitted */
122 
123 		if (length > 0)		/* more data to send? */
124 			at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_THR, *buf++);
125 	} while (length);
126 
127 	/* Send Stop */
128 	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_STOP);
129 
130 	return 0;
131 }
132 
133 /*
134  * Generic i2c master transfer entrypoint.
135  *
136  * Note: We do not use Atmel's feature of storing the "internal device address".
137  * Instead the "internal device address" has to be written using a separate
138  * i2c message.
139  * http://lists.arm.linux.org.uk/pipermail/linux-arm-kernel/2004-September/024411.html
140  */
at91_xfer(struct i2c_adapter * adap,struct i2c_msg * pmsg,int num)141 static int at91_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, struct i2c_msg *pmsg, int num)
142 {
143 	int i, ret;
144 
145 	d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"at91_xfer: processing %d messages:\n", num);
146 
147 	for (i = 0; i < num; i++) {
148 		dev_dbg(&adap->dev, " #%d: %sing %d byte%s %s 0x%02x\n", i,
149 			p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D ? "read" : "writ",
150 			pmsg->len, pmsg->len > 1 ? "s" : "",
151 			p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D ? "from" : "to",	pmsg->addr);
152 
153 		at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_MMR, (pmsg->addr << 16)
154 			| ((p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D) ? AT91_TWI_MREAD : 0));
155 
156 		if (pmsg->len && pmsg->buf) {	/* sanity check */
157 			if (p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D)
158 				ret = xfer_read(adap, pmsg->buf, pmsg->len);
159 			else
160 				ret = xfer_write(adap, pmsg->buf, pmsg->len);
161 
162 			if (ret)
163 				return ret;
164 
165 			/* Wait until transfer is finished */
166 			if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_TXCOMP)) {
167 				d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"TXCOMP timeout\n");
168 				return -ETIMEDOUT;
169 			}
170 		}
171 		d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"transfer complete\n");
172 		pmsg++;		/* next message */
173 	}
174 	return i;
175 }
